How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sugar Mill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sugar Mill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,590 | $1,200 | $2,250 |
| Sugar Mill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,988 | $1,180 | $3,426 |
| Sugar Mill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,427 | $1,815 | $3,848 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Sugar Mill Apartments
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Sugar Mill?
The cheapest apartment in Sugar Mill is The Foundry Duluth which is listed at $1,360, while the average apartment in Sugar Mill costs $1,830.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Sugar Mill?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 15 regular apartments in Sugar Mill that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
